Internal Memo — Budget Request

To the sales leads: Operations has submitted a budget request to fund two additional demo kits for the Vellane product line and travel support for the Ashgrove territory push. Finance expects a decision within two weeks. No changes to current spending limits until then; log any urgent needs with your regional coordinator. Background on the request's purpose appears below.

board note of fahaf-fadug: Gilixax Logistics is in early talks to buy Praiusax Partners for about $8.1 million. The Pramir launch date is September 23, and nothing goes to the press before then.

Leadership Review Briefing — Possible Acquisition of Fennick Labs

Quick primer before Thursday: Fennick Labs is a small sensor outfit based in Oakhurst with a tidy patent portfolio and a founder who's open to talking. Their revenue is modest but growing fast, and their tech would plug the gap in our Halcyon product roadmap nicely. Due diligence would take roughly ten weeks. Valuation chatter puts them at the upper end of what we'd stomach. The strategic rationale is laid out in the note below.

internal memo for kaduf-baduf: Only 35 of the 378 pilot accounts renewed Holir, so a churn review is set for June 11. Eliielax Group is in early talks to buy Silaelix Group for about $142.1 million.

**Break-Glass: Locale Date Patch Channel**

If a localization bug ships broken date formats in a Quillway release, the release manager may push a hotfix through the emergency channel without the full sign-off cycle. All break-glass pushes are logged and reviewed next business day. To open the emergency channel, authenticate with the passphrase below.

unlock words, hahip-baduf: holwyn-istath-julvan